Comparison of MERN, MEAN, MEVN, and LAMP Stack to Hire a Developer

Picture of Admin
Admin
Stack Developer

The power of technological advancement is one to which we are constantly exposed. Ten years ago, the world was introduced to a range of new technologies, including social media, cloud computing, IoT and machine learning. These technologies have transformed the way we do business.

We have all the newest mobile apps, smartwatches, and earphones – and don’t forget fitness trackers and AI-enabled devices. And you can find electric cars too!

Stack is a clear frontrunner in the web and mobile development industry. Select the right stack for your product, and you’ll be set for success!

This article will highlight some important attributes of the most common stacks and their pros and cons. This will help you choose which stack is best for your development company.

What is MEAN Stack?

MEAN stack is a group of JavaScript-based open-source web application frameworks that can be used to build entire websites and applications. MEAN stands for M for MongoDB, E for Express.js, A for AngularJS and N for Node.js, which all work together to provide an excellent development environment.

Want to hire MEAN Stack developer for your Next project?

You Are Just A Tap Away

Top 5 Benefits of MEAN Stack

How to hire MEAN Stack developer? Before hiring MEAN Stack developer, it’s important to know the MEAN stack benefits and why it has become so popular. Are you aware of the top 5 benefits of using the MEAN stack? If not, read more about the five key benefits of using this technology and how it can impact your business.

Easy API Integration

Because the REST API is so simple, you can connect it to any third-party service or application. You don’t have to fret about changing your website to accommodate a new customer integration. This means you’ll have more time to spend on your core business instead of chasing down integrations.

Better Performance

One of the best things about using a MEAN stack is that it provides better performance than many other options. The Node.js framework comprises an event-driven and non-blocking I/O model, which can handle more concurrent connections with lower latency, making it ideal for real-time applications.

Effortless Swapping between Client and Server

The MEAN Stack can be coded in only one language, JavaScript. Because web applications are made in only one language, developers can easily switch back and forth between the client and server. Developers don’t need a separate server; on the contrary, they can quickly deploy web applications on a server.

Cost-Effective

That MEAN is free is a definite advantage to companies, and the fact that they only need to know a single programming language means they will find development easier. A lot of organizations that build with the MEAN stack hire JavaScript experts.

Open Source

MEAN stack is an open-source web application framework to develop and deploy dynamic, data-driven websites. It includes MongoDB, a document-oriented database; Express.js, an open-source server-side JavaScript framework; Angular.js, a front-end web application framework; and Node.js, a server-side runtime environment based on Google’s V8 engine designed for developing scalable network applications quickly and efficiently.
A top benefit of using the MEAN stack does no need to worry about server administration. This means you can focus on your product instead of taking care of everything needed for a secure and reliable product. Another benefit is the technology is easy to update. Hire MEAN Stack Development Company in your area will be able to update this software at any time without any worry, saving you time and money.

What is MERN Stack?

MERN stack is a JavaScript-based full-stack framework that integrates MongoDB, Express.js, React.js, and Node.js to create a powerful web application. With the right development company and a clear understanding of the benefits of using this type of framework, you can build applications faster than ever!

Top 5 Benefits of MERN Stack

At this point, the MERN stack should be one of your top considerations when you’re looking to build an app or website. It’s cross-platform, versatile, and simple to use—all things that make it the perfect candidate to meet your needs. Hire MERN stack development company for all your needs.

No context switching

One of the top benefits of the MERN stack is that it integrates Node.js, Express.js, React.js and Node.js into one cohesive platform. It means you can work on your app’s front and backend simultaneously without any latency or issues with compatibility that might arise from using different languages for each part of your app’s architecture. It also means that you don’t need to hire MERN stack developer who knows how to work in both languages – you have one person do everything!

Easy to Scale with Modular Architecture

MERN is a full-stack JavaScript framework for developing web and mobile applications. MERN has a modular architecture that makes it easy to scale applications using microservices, i.e., small units or modules in a system designed to perform one specific task to optimize efficiency and performance.

Strong Community

The first benefit is the strong community. The open-source nature of this stack means that you can always locate people willing to help you when you need it. It also means that there are a ton of tutorials, videos and code snippets that you can utilize as a starting point for your project.

Code Maintenance

The JavaScript ecosystem is a vast and wonderful place, but it can also be difficult to keep up with all the new libraries being released daily. This is where Code Maintenance comes in. Code Maintenance automatically updates your library dependencies based on your package.json file and then runs the necessary commands to update them.

UI rendering and performance

React JS is a great option for UI abstraction since it is just a library, giving you the freedom to design your application however you like. It is better with regards to UI rendering and performance than Angular.
So now you’ve learned how to hire MERN stack developer. Keep these tips in mind as you seek out the best possible candidate. And if you need any additional help, know that we’re always willing to lend a hand at Codal!

What is MEVN Stack?

This stack uses Vue.js as a front-end framework. It’s particularly popular among developers because Vue.js provides rapid development and effectiveness over other front-end frameworks, such as Angular.js and React.js. Vue.js framework includes some core functionality that can be augmented by adding third-party features. 
In one sense, we can say that Vue.js possesses the best aspects of both Angular and React and will use ExpressJS to achieve optimum performance along with the super-rich set of tools.

Top 5 Benefits of MEVN Stack

MEVN Stack is an amazing collection of software packages and development languages, which can become quite powerful in combination! Here are five reasons you should consider using this software stack rather than some other tech stack you might be considering now. Hire MEVN stack developer if you want to take the edges of these benefits.

Open-source Javascript frameworks

MEAN stack is an open-source Javascript framework that allows developers to create and deploy full-stack web applications. In addition, it is an ideal solution for those who want to use only one programming language to build their apps. It also has many features, including a built-in preprocessor, template engine, and module loader.

MVC capability

MEVN stack is the acronym for MongoDB, Express, Vue.js and Node.js. The MVC capability allows for separation between data and logic in the backend and front-end for easier updates to UI without having to change a lot of code in the backend.

Highly secure

MEVN is an end-to-end encryption technology that provides a highly secure and encrypted messaging experience. The MEVN stack consists of Message Encryption, Verification, and Notification.

Message Encryption ensures that your data is never stored on any outside servers or devices while in transit. It uses asymmetric encryption to encrypt the data with a private key, which cannot be accessed by anyone other than the receiver – even if they have access to your public key. Furthermore, it can also be used for authentication purposes and enabling a sender’s assurance that the intended recipient has received their message.

Verification lets you know when your message has been delivered successfully to its destination so you can rest easy knowing it hasn’t been intercepted along the way. Verification confirms this when messages are delivered securely from one person to another without being altered in any way.

The notification includes feedback at every step of the process. Allowing users to know who has read their messages and how long ago they were read will keep people on top of all updates, ensuring they aren’t missing anything important.

Greater adaptability & flexibility

MEVN stack provides greater flexibility and adaptability than other web frameworks. It is also a server-side JavaScript framework, making it more powerful than front-end frameworks like React. As long as you have Node.js installed on your computer, you can use the MEVN stack to build your project without installing any other dependencies or libraries.

Easy to learn

MEVN stack is a JavaScript library that provides a set of common user interface elements, such as forms, buttons, menus and dialogues. MEAN stack is the equivalent of server-side programming languages like Node.js.

The entire framework is not large and can be learned quickly by even novice programmers.
If you want to assemble your business successfully, you will need some good resources to help you develop a great website and host the services. That’s where Hire MEVN stack development company comes into play. Esferasoft has a team of experts who can help you develop a website or an app for your business and build your cloud or on-premise private server. Whatever service you need, we can get it done for you without any headache and all at a very affordable cost.

What is LAMP Stack?

LAMP stack is a group of software that work together to create a server environment. LAMP stands for Linux, Apache as well as MySQL, and PHP/Python/Perl. It is open-source and one of the most popular alternatives when it comes to web hosting services. With this combination, you can get your website up and running with very little technical knowledge required.

5 Benefits of Lamp Stack

It’s important to remember that when you hire Lamp stack development company, Lamp stack developers or Hire Lamp Stack development team, they’ll develop the software according to your requirements and needs. However, here are five benefits you can enjoy from choosing Lamp stack development as your solution stack.

Open source

Lamp stack is a free and open-source software stack. A bundle of software that can be used to run dynamic websites, applications and web services. It’s often referred to as LAMP because it consists of Linux, Apache, MySQL and PHP (or Perl). The name is derived from the first letter in each word. This post will summarize how these four components work together to create a powerful solution for dynamic web content.

Scalability and Performance

LAMP stack is a bunch of open-source software programs designed for web development and deployment. The acronym LAMP stands for Linux, Apache, MySQL and PHP. These programs are capable of providing scalability and performance to your website. One major benefit is that because it is open source, the LAMP stack allows you to tweak the software’s code as needed, and it will be free to do so.

Customization

Additionally, we can easily customize our stack and interchange its components with other open-source software to meet our business requirements. Additionally, Apache is modular in design, so you can find different modules that can be customized to fit our needs. 

Security and Reliability

As a web app developer, ensure your end user’s data is safe. You don’t want to be the person responsible for a security breach. With the LAMP stack, you can have the relaxation of the mind that your site will be secure from intrusions and will be reliable when it comes to uptime. Whether you’re using Apache, MySQL, or PHP in conjunction, they all work together to ensure your site stays up and running.

Modular Architecture

LAMP stack is a modular architecture that consists of a Linux operating system, Apache HTTP server, MySQL or MariaDB database, and PHP programming language. Though it’s not the only combination used to build dynamic web pages and applications, the LAMP stack has become one of the most popular because it is free and open-source. It’s also great for developers because they can install whichever components they need without worrying about compatibility issues.
LAMP stack is one of the most popular programming languages for building and developing websites. If you are on funding and need to hire a dedicated developer to work with your team on this project, find someone with experience. Hire lamp stack developer now!

Why Choose Esferasoft For Your Mean Stack, Mern Stack, Mevn Stack, And Lamp Stack

Esferasoft is the only company that provides all resources under one roof. It allows you to have an all-in-one solution for your project. Plus, because we’re a single source for everything, we can give you various options and help you decide what is best for your specific needs. The best part about our service is that we provide a team of professionals with the latest technologies, ready to take on any challenge you bring their way.

All of our stacks are flexible, reliable and scalable. They are also backed by a team of experts who are ready to help you every stage of the way. So whether it’s bug fixes or adding new features, there’s nothing we can’t do. Contact us today!

FAQs

What is the function of a LAMP stack?

LAMP is a web-developing stack that has efficiency and flexibility and enables developers to stay on pace with mainstream commercial solutions. Web-based developers may find this an optimal solution for creating, managing and hosting web-based content.

In Mongo DB apps, should I use the Mern stack or the Mean stack?

From a broader perspective, there are a few differences between the Mean stack and Mern stack. Mean stack uses Angular for front-end web applications. At the same time, the Mern stack uses React and is efficient for applications based on MongoDB.

Full-stack versus mean stack–how would React.js developers react?

Mean stack developers are typically adept at four technologies: MongoDB, Express.js, Angular, and Node.js. They can work on any stage of the development cycle with minimal distractions or issues. Full-stack developers, meanwhile, have fewer limitations.

Conclusion

As we mentioned, there are multiple criteria to assess when deciding what technology stack to use, but you should also examine it from a developer’s perspective.

In such a case, it depends on the technical specifications of the project that need to be built that decide what programming language should be used. MEAN stack is the ideal tool to take care of complicated enterprise solutions. Many popular and prestigious companies are adopting it for their online solutions, such as HBO, NASA, Nike and YouTube.

React.js framework within the MERN stack makes it easy to code the UI. The ease of context switching is one big relief for developers, as they can use one language throughout their development.
If you want to create a RESTful application with capabilities such as built-in real-time functionality, then MEVN is the right choice. It offers the best of MERN and MEAN by giving you a wide range of robust features, such as in-built storage engines that help you create the performance-orientated or lightweight apps you want, such as e-commerce platforms, social media, and gaming portals.

The right choice is to use LAMP & MEAN or MERN for a complex enterprise solution with lots of customization, flexibility, cost-effectiveness, and robust security.

[atlasvoice]
Picture of John Doe
John Doe

Listen to this article

[atlasvoice]

Contact
Information

Have a web or mobile app project in mind? Let us discuss making your project a reality.

Email Sent

Your submission has been received.
we will be in touch and connect you soon